Kenya (KEBS) - Adoption of Standard DKS 251:2020 on Motor Vehicle Radiators
On October 22, 2020, the Kenya Bureau of Standards (KEBS) has informed the adoption of the standard DKS 251:2020 on motor vehicle radiators on August 21, 2020. This Kenya Standard covers the general requirements and methods of test for automotive radiators manufactured from copper and brass with brackets of steel for use on motor cars, trucks, tractors and off-the road vehicles such as earth moving machinery. Radiators utilizing bolted or cast header tanks are excluded.
Technical reference:
- IS 7611—Specification for automotive radiators — Copper brass core construction.
- IS 3331 — Specification for copper and brass strips/foils for radiator cores.
Proposed date of entry into force: Upon declaration as mandatory by the relevant Cabinet Secretary
